Start with the workload, not the smallest box
If the budget is tight, the Minisforum NAB6 Lite i5 8GB/512GB at R4,150 is the sensible entry point. Its 8GB memory and 512GB storage suit browsing, streaming, school projects, office work, and older or lighter games, but it is not the pick for a heavy media library.
The UM750L 16GB/1TB at R4,600 is the stronger everyday choice because 16GB memory gives more breathing room and 1TB storage makes it easier to keep project files, game installs, and downloads on the same machine. For only a small jump from the R4,150 option, it feels better balanced.
For buyers who want more headroom, the GEEKOM A8 Max 32GB/1TB at R12,900 is the premium compact option in this set. Its 32GB memory is the key reason to consider it for heavier multitasking, larger timelines, and a cleaner long-term desk setup.
Creator Desk Or Gaming Room Choice For SA Homes
On a shared student desk or a compact creator desk, the NINKEAR M7 16GB/512GB at R4,650 makes sense when you want 16GB memory but do not need 1TB storage. If storage matters more, the NINKEAR M8 16GB/1TB at R8,350 gives the same memory figure with a larger 1TB drive.
